By the editors · 2 min readSmoke and nutmeg create an intense opening—charred and warmly spicy with a peppery edge. Raspberry introduces a faint fruity sweetness that cuts through the smokiness, while ylang-ylang adds a floral creaminess. Cedar provides a dry woody backbone, lending structure and a pencil-shaving aroma. Patchouli and styrax deepen the base with earthy, balsamic resins, and castoreum contributes a animalic leather nuance. The scent is complex and evolving, with strong projection and excellent longevity. Best worn in cool weather for evening or formal occasions, its bold character commands attention.
